Poverty and inequality are ubiquitous. A scientific approach to fighting poverty can yield impressive results, both as a way of efficiently allocating scarce resources and as a tool for determining what policies are most effective. Eliana La Ferrara, professor of development economics at Bocconi, describes how science can help disadvantaged communities both in the rich world and in developing countries. She has interesting stories to share involving how to use educational media for empowering women, and other underprivileged groups.
